Javascript JqueryUI日期选择器日期对象的问题

Javascript JqueryUI日期选择器日期对象的问题,javascript,jquery,jquery-ui,jquery-ui-datepicker,Javascript,Jquery,Jquery Ui,Jquery Ui Datepicker,我从服务器端得到如下日期 endDate : Mon Nov 07 00:00:00 CET 2011 (Java.util.Date) startDate : Fri Feb 04 00:00:00 CET 2011 (Java.util.Date) 现在我有两个jQueryUIDatePicker 我想限制这两个日期选择器,以便用户只能从上述日期中选择日期 我觉得你可以为日期选择器设置minDate和maxDate 我做了以下几件事: $("#startDatePicker").dat

我从服务器端得到如下日期

 endDate : Mon Nov 07 00:00:00 CET 2011 (Java.util.Date)
 startDate : Fri Feb 04 00:00:00 CET 2011 (Java.util.Date)
现在我有两个jQueryUIDatePicker

我想限制这两个日期选择器,以便用户只能从上述日期中选择日期

我觉得你可以为日期选择器设置minDate和maxDate

我做了以下几件事:

$("#startDatePicker").datepicker({
minDate: $.datepicker.formatDate( 'dd.mm.yy',new Date(startDate.getTime())),
maxDate: $.datepicker.formatDate( 'dd.mm.yy',new Date(endDate.getTime())),
...

$("#endDatePicker").datepicker({
minDate: $.datepicker.formatDate( 'dd.mm.yy',new Date(startDate.getTime())),
maxDate: $.datepicker.formatDate( 'dd.mm.yy',new Date(endDate.getTime())),
...
但有点不对劲。在开始日期选择器中,他显示的是2020年。?结束日期选择器他禁用了日期选择器中的所有内容。我不明白这里怎么了?

添加:jQuery插件

代码

测试样本:

 <script type="test/javascript">
       alert($.format.date("Wed Jan 13 10:43:41 CET 2010", "dd/MM/yyyy"));
 </script>

警报($.format.date(“Wed Jan 13 10:43:41 CET 2010”,“dd/MM/yyyy”);
 <script type="test/javascript">
       alert($.format.date("Wed Jan 13 10:43:41 CET 2010", "dd/MM/yyyy"));
 </script>